div.background
  {
  width:440px;
  height:250px;
  background:url(klematis.jpg) repeat;
  border:0px solid black;
  }
div.transbox
  {
  width:380px;
  height:270px;
  margin:30px 50px;
  background-color:#ffffff;
  border:1px solid black;
  opacity:0.94;
  filter:alpha(opacity=94); /* For IE8 and earlier */
  }
div.transbox p
  {
  margin:30px 40px;
  font-weight:bold;
  color:#000000;
  }
  
  div.backgroundtitle
  {
  width:990px;
  height:63px;
  background:url(klematis.jpg) repeat;
  border:0px solid black;
  }
div.transboxtitle
  {
  width:950px;
  height:83px;
  margin:50px 20px;
  background-color:#2D1E9E;
  border:1px solid yellow;
  opacity:0.94;
  filter:alpha(opacity=94); /* For IE8 and earlier */
  }
div.transboxtitle p
  {
  margin:30px 40px;
  font-weight:bold;
  color:#000000;
  }
  
  div.backgroundcnp
  {
  width:990px;
  height:460px;
  background:url(klematis.jpg) repeat;
  border:0px solid black;
  }
div.transboxcnp
  {
  width:950px;
  height:540px;
  margin:55px 20px;
  background-color:#2D1E9E;
  border:1px solid yellow;
  opacity:0.94;
  filter:alpha(opacity=94); /* For IE8 and earlier */
  }
div.transboxcnp p
  {
  margin:30px 40px;
  font-weight:bold;
  color:#000000;
  }
  
  div.backgrounderror
  {
  width:500px;
  height:300px;
  background:url(klematis.jpg) repeat;
  border:0px solid black;
  }
div.transboxerror
  {
   width:400px;
  height:330px;
  margin:30px 50px;
  background-color:#ffffff;
  border:1px solid black;
  opacity:0.94;
  filter:alpha(opacity=94); /* For IE8 and earlier */
  }
div.transboxerror p
  {
   margin:30px 40px;
  font-weight:bold;
  color:#000000;
  }
	.salveaza
    {
    	
      width: 150px;
      height: 40px;
      color:red;
      cursor:pointer;
      font-size: 11;
      background-position: center;
      background-color:#D6FFFE;
    }
    
     .salveaza:hover 
    {
     
      width: 150px;
      height: 40px;
      color:red;
      cursor:pointer;
      font-size: 11;
      background-position: center;
      background-color:#E9FF86;
      
    }
	
	.login
    {
    
      background: url(/taxe_boisoara/images/client.jpg) no-repeat;
      width: 90px;
      height: 25px;
      //color:blue;
      cursor:pointer;
      //font-size: 11;
      background-position: left;
      background-color:#D6FFFE;
    }
    
     .login:hover 
    {
     
      background: url(/taxe_boisoara/images/client.jpg) no-repeat;
      width: 90px;
      height: 25px;
      color:blue;
      cursor:pointer;
      //font-size: 11;
      background-position: left;
      background-color:#E9FF86;
      
    }

   .login:inapoi 
    {
     
      background: url(/taxe_boisoara/images/stinga.png) no-repeat;
      width: 90px;
      height: 25px;
      color:blue;
      cursor:pointer;
      //font-size: 11;
      background-position: left;
      background-color:#E9FF86;
      
    }

    .inchide
    {
      color:blue;
      cursor:pointer;
      font-size: 12;
   
    }
    
	.blue 
	{

	background: url(/images/calcule11.png) no-repeat;
	background-position: center;
    background-color:#D6FFFE;
    font-size:12px;
    cursor:not-allowed;
	}

	.blue:hover 
	{
	
	background: url(/images/calcule11.png) no-repeat;
	background-position: center;
    background-color:#E9FF86;
    font-size:12px;
    cursor:not-allowed;
	}

    .text
    {
	background-color:#FEFFD7;
	border: 1px solid #006;
	text-align:center;
	cursor:pointer;
    }
    
     .text:hover 
    {
	background-color:#E7F702;
	text-align:center;
	cursor:pointer;
      }
      
        input.text:focus
	{
		background-color:yellow;
		text-align:center;
	}
    
     .selcolor
    {
      background-color:#ffffff;
      font-family:Aria bold;
	  border: 1px solid #006;
      font-size:14px;
     color:blue;
    }
    
     .selcolor:hover 
    {
     
	background-color:#DEFED1;
	font-family:Aria bold;
	font-size:14px;
	border: 1px solid #006;
	color:black;
	cursor:pointer;
      
    }
	
	.selcolorintrodu
    {
      background-color:#FFFAA4;
      font-family:Aria bold;
	  text-align:center;
	  border: 1px solid #006;
      font-size:14px;
     color:blue;
    }
    
     .selcolorintrodu:hover 
    {
     
	background-color:#FFF988;
	font-family:Aria bold;
	font-size:14px;
	text-align:center;
	border: 1px solid #006;
	color:black;
	cursor:pointer;
      
    }
	
	.selcolorcnperor
    {
      background-color:#ffffff;
      font-family:Aria bold;
	  border: 1px solid #006;
      font-size:14px;
     color:red;
    }
	
	 .selcolorcenter
    {
      background-color:#ffffff;
      font-family:Aria bold;
	  text-align:center;
	  border: 1px solid #006;
      font-size:14px;
     color:blue;
    }
    
     .selcolorcenter:hover 
    {
     
	background-color:#DEFED1;
	font-family:Aria bold;
	text-align:center;
	font-size:14px;
	border: 1px solid #006;
	color:black;
	cursor:pointer;
      
    }
    
    .selcolor:focus
	{
		background-color:#FCFF92;
		border: 1px solid #006;
	}
    
     .optionsel
    {

       background-color:#303559;
       font-family:Arial bold;
       font-size:14px;
       color:white;
       cursor:pointer;
    }
	

    option.emphasised 
    {
	background-color: red; 
	font-weight: bold; 
	font-size: 12px; 
	color: white;
    }
    
      .cursorblock
    {
	cursor:not-allowed;
	background-color:#F5F5F5;
	text-align:center;
	border: 1px solid #D40606;
	
    }
	
	  .cursorblockcombo
    {
	text-align:center;	
	cursor:not-allowed;
	 -moz-border-radius: 7px;
	-webkit-border-radius: 7px;
	-moz-box-shadow: 0 1px 3px rgba(0,0,5,0.5);
	-webkit-box-shadow: 0 1px 3px rgba(0,0,0,0.5);
	background-color:#F5F5F5;
	color:#000000;
	border: 1px solid #D40606;
	
    }
	
	 .cursorblocktable
    {
	text-align:center;	
	cursor:not-allowed;
	 -moz-border-radius: 7px;
	-webkit-border-radius: 7px;
	-moz-box-shadow: 0 1px 3px rgba(0,0,5,0.5);
	-webkit-box-shadow: 0 1px 3px rgba(0,0,0,0.5);
	background-color:#FFFEDB;
	color:#000000;
	border: 1px solid #5052FD;
	
    }
	
	 .border
    {
	text-align:center;	
	cursor:not-allowed;
	 -moz-border-radius: 7px;
	-webkit-border-radius: 7px;
	-moz-box-shadow: 0 1px 3px rgba(0,0,5,0.5);
	-webkit-box-shadow: 0 1px 3px rgba(0,0,0,0.5);
	background-color:#F51B1B;
	color:#000000;
	border: 1px solid #D40606;
	
    }
	
	 .titleborder
    {
	text-align:center;	
	cursor:not-allowed;
	 -moz-border-radius: 7px;
	-webkit-border-radius: 7px;
	-moz-box-shadow: 0 1px 3px rgba(0,0,5,0.5);
	-webkit-box-shadow: 0 1px 3px rgba(0,0,0,0.5);
	background-color:#3D2BFB;
	color:#000000;
	//border: 1px solid #D40606;
	
    }
    
    iframe {
    
  -moz-border-radius: 12px;
  -webkit-border-radius: 12px; 
  border-radius: 12px; 
  border: 2px solid #006;

  -moz-box-shadow: 4px 4px 14px #000; 
  -webkit-box-shadow: 4px 4px 14px #000; 
  box-shadow: 4px 4px 14px #000; 


}


  td.bold {
    

}

  td.bold:hover  {
    
background: url(/images/create.png) no-repeat;
background-position: left;
  background-color:#E94619;
  border: 1px solid #A75508;
  cursor:pointer;

}

 td.flipp {
    
  -moz-border-radius: 12px;
  -webkit-border-radius: 12px; 
  border-radius: 12px; 
  background-color:#4A4341;
  border: 1px solid #A75508;

  -moz-box-shadow: 4px 4px 14px #000; 
  -webkit-box-shadow: 4px 4px 14px #000; 
  box-shadow: 4px 4px 14px #000; 

}

 td.flipp:hover {
    
  -moz-border-radius: 12px;
  -webkit-border-radius: 12px; 
  border-radius: 12px; 
  background-color:#4A4788;
  border: 1px solid #A75508;

  -moz-box-shadow: 4px 4px 14px #000; 
  -webkit-box-shadow: 4px 4px 14px #000; 
  box-shadow: 4px 4px 14px #000; 

}

 .infr
    {
	background-color:#FEFFD7;
	border: 1px solid #006;
	 -moz-border-radius: 7px;
	-webkit-border-radius: 7px;
	-moz-box-shadow: 0 1px 3px rgba(0,0,5,0.5);
	-webkit-box-shadow: 0 1px 3px rgba(0,0,0,0.5);
	cursor:pointer;
    }
	
	
   .tooltip {
    background-color:#000;
    border:1px solid #fff;
    padding:10px 15px;
    width:200px;
    display:none;
    color:#fff;
    text-align:left;
    font-size:12px;
 
    /* outline radius for mozilla/firefox only */
    -moz-box-shadow:0 0 10px #000;
    -webkit-box-shadow:0 0 10px #000;
}

  .cursorblockselect
    {
	cursor:not-allowed;
	 -moz-border-radius: 7px;
	-webkit-border-radius: 7px;
	-moz-box-shadow: 0 1px 3px rgba(0,0,5,0.5);
	-webkit-box-shadow: 0 1px 3px rgba(0,0,0,0.5);
	background-color:#F5F5F5;
	color:#000000;
	border: 1px solid #D40606;
	
    }
	
a.style
{
color: #00f;
text-decoration: none
}

a.style:hover
{
color: #B1001A;
text-decoration: underline
}

a.stylecolor
{
color: #D4021E;
text-decoration: none
}

a.stylecolor:hover
{
color: #00f;
text-decoration: underline
}

.sel
    {
      background-color:#FEFFD7;
      font-family:Aria bold;
      font-size:14px;
      -moz-border-radius: 7px;
    -webkit-border-radius: 7px;
    -moz-box-shadow: 0 1px 3px rgba(0,0,5,0.5);
    -webkit-box-shadow: 0 1px 3px rgba(0,0,0,0.5);
     color:blue;
    }
    
     .sel:hover 
    {
     
      background-color:#E7F702;
       font-family:Aria bold;
       font-size:14px;
      -moz-border-radius: 7px;
    -webkit-border-radius: 7px;
    -moz-box-shadow: 0 1px 3px rgba(0,0,5,0.5);
    -webkit-box-shadow: 0 1px 3px rgba(0,0,0,0.5);
      color:black;
      cursor:pointer;
      
    }
    
    .sel:focus
	{
		background-color:yellow;
	}
	



